Abstract:
A seal ring with a sliding surface, which is obtained by molding a molding powder or granulated powder of non-melt-moldable modified polytetrafluoroethylene containing 0.01 to 1% by weight of a perfluorovinylether unit represented by the formula (I): —CF2—CF(—O—X)— (I) wherein X represents a perfluoroalkyl group having 1 to 6 carbon atoms or a perfluoroalkoxyalkyl group having 2 to 9 carbon atoms, the modified polytetrafluoroethylene having a heat of crystallization of 18 to 25J/g measured by a differential scanning calorimeter.
Abstract:
To provide a granular PTFE powder having a low electrostatic charging property even after drying. A process for preparing a low-electrostatically-charging granular polytetrafluoroethylene powder by contacting a polar group-containing organic compound having an electrostatic charging-preventing ability when substantially dry to a granular polytetrafluoroethylene powder and then drying the granular powder while the polar group-containing organic compound is kept remaining in the granular powder.
Abstract:
There is provided a resin powder for molding which comprises 35 to 98% by weight of a polytetrafluoroethylene powder having an average particle size of not more than 120 &mgr;m, 35 to 2% by weight of a heat resistant aromatic polyoxybenzoyl ester resin powder subjected to water repelling treatment and 30 to 0% by weight of an inorganic filler, has an apparent density of not less than 0.6 g/cm3 and an average particle size of not more than 800 &mgr;m, and provides a molded article having an elongation at break of not less than 20%. The resin powder for molding is free from separation of a filler, has excellent flowability and apparent density which are important characteristics in handling the powder, and can provide a PTFE molded article having a high elongation which has not been obtained.

Abstract:
Filler-containing polytetrafluoroethylene granular powder, which has a large apparent density, a small average particle size, a narrow particle size distribution, a superior powder flowability, a small electrostatic charge and gives a molded product having a superior tensile strength and elongation a high degree of whiteness and a low surface roughness, and a process for preparing the same. The granulation is carried out by stirring, in water, of a PTFE powder and a filler in the presence of an organic liquid forming liquid-liquid interface with water and an anionic surfactant and/or nonionic surfactant such as a segmented polyalkylene glycol having a hydrophobic segment and hydrophilic segment and deagglomerating of the powder.
Abstract:
A continuous plasma CVD apparatus, characterized in that frequency of high-frequency bias is in the range of 50-900 KHz, a blocking condenser is provided between a thin film and a high-frequency source so that the product C·f of electrostatic capacity C of the blocking condenser and frequency f of the high-frequency source is 0.02 [F·Hz] or more, and the total of impedances of all the rollers provided in the route of from a substrate unwind roller to a rotating drum is 10 k&OHgr; or more and the total of impedances of all the rollers provided in the route of from the rotating drum to a wind roller is 10 k&OHgr; or more. According to this apparatus, it becomes possible to continuously form a film without causing damage and deterioration of the substrate.
Abstract:
A preparation process in which PTFE coarse particles are finely pulverized into particles in wet state, thus enabling the finely pulverized particles to be washed as they are and an amount of impurities to be decreased efficiently and after the washing, agglomeration granulation is carried out, thus enabling PTFE molding powder to be obtained in the reduced number of steps; a preparation process of a polytetrafluoroethylene molding powder, characterized in that polytetrafluoroethylene coarse particles obtained by suspension polymerization of tetrafluoroethylene are finely pulverized, in wet state, into an average particle size particularly in a range of 10 to 100 .mu.m and then washed; and a preparation process of a polytetrafluoroethylene molding powder, characterized in that after the washing, mechanical force is applied to the washed powder in wet state for agglomeration granulation, thus giving particles having an average particle size in a range of 200 to 800 .mu.m.

Abstract:
In a lighting control apparatus of a control panel in an automobile, a brightness reduction characteristic of a control panel lighting unit relative to a brightness signal of a brightness control unit is previously set according to external operation. The brightness control unit gives a brightness signal for controlling a luminosity of an instrument panel and a luminosity of a control panel which is provided near the instrument panel to a luminosity corresponding to an operation of a dimmer knob. When the brightness signal is given from the brightness control unit, the brightness of the control panel lighting unit is controlled according to a set brightness reduction characteristic relative to the brightness signal of the brightness control unit. Thereby, it is possible to make the luminosity of the control panel relative to the instrument panel a desired brightness characteristic.
Abstract:
An output circuit comprises an output transistor circuit for applying an output signal to a transmission line connected to an output terminal, a circuit for driving the output transistor circuit in response to an input signal applied to an input terminal, and a control circuit by which the signal amplitude of a first wave applicable to the transmission line with a load connected to the output terminal through the transmission line is rendered approximately one half of the output signal amplitude with a load directly connected to the output terminal. The control circuit includes a monitoring transistor within the same chip as the output transistor circuit, a selected one of the output resistance and input signal of the output transistor circuit being controlled in accordance with the magnitude of the drain current of the monitoring transistor to adjust the amplitude of the signal applied to the transmission line. Transmission with transmitting and receiving ends having a well-defined transmission waveform is obtained, thereby making possible high-speed signal transmission between LSI chips.
Abstract:
To provide a filler-containing or non-filler-containing polytetrafluoroethylene granular powder having a high apparent density, a small electrostatic charge and a superior powder flowability and giving a molded product which is free from lowering of tensile strength and elongation and coloring attributable to the surfactant and has a high degree of whiteness, and a process for preparing the same. The granulation is carried out by wetting 100 part by weight of a polytetrafluoroethylene powder or a mixture of polytetrafluoroethylene powder and filler with 30 to 60 parts by weight of an aqueous solution containing a nonionic surfactant having a hydrophobic segment comprising a poly(oxyalkylene) unit having 3 or 4 carbon atoms and a hydrophilic segment comprising a poly(oxyethylene) unit and then applying a mechanical force to the wetted polytetrafluoroethylene powder or the wetted mixture of polytetrafluoroethylene powder and filler.
